New Director of Bands & Fine Arts Announced

Tracy Carter

Tracy Carter is a native of Jackson, MS where she attended and graduated from Jackson Academy. During and after high school, she participated as a color guard member, educator, and designer for various WGI and DCI organizations spanning over 20 years.

A graduate of the University of Southern Mississippi, Carter holds a Bachelors Degree in Music Education and Oboe Performance where she served as the Principal Oboist for the Wind Ensemble under Dr. Thomas Fraschillo as well as the USM Symphony Orchestra under Jay Dean. She continued at USM to earn her Master’s Degree in Conducting.

As an educator, Ms. Carter has spent 15 years teaching band students in various public schools in Mississippi ranging from grades 6-12. Before coming to Biloxi, Tracy served as an assistant band director at Madison Central High School in Madison, Mississippi. Her marching and musical ensembles consistently received top ratings and multiple championships.

Ms. Carter currently resides in Biloxi, MS where she is the Head Band Director at Biloxi Junior High as well as the Program Coordinator for the Biloxi High Marching band. She also serves as the Color Guard Director for the Biloxi Public School System.

“The last two and half years working with the students, staff, and administration at Biloxi have been the most joyful and gratifying time of my teaching career. I am beyond grateful for this opportunity to help continue to build the incredible arts environment we have here.”
